Description

The date plum tree of Yonggok-ri near Soemokgol is located at the former site of houses of the Gyeongju Kim Clan that were built here about 300 years ago. This date plum has been preserved as the village’s ritual tree, and even now, on the 15th day of the first lunar month, shamans perform a ritual to invoke the descent of the deity to the tree. Date plum is often used as “trunk wood” when grafting persimmon trees. As we can tell from an old saying, “Date plums are sweeter than persimmons” or “Seventy date plums are not as good as one persimmon”, the date plum is a familiar tree, but it is not easy to find big date plums. This date plum tree is the largest of its kind identified so far, and has great folkloric value.
